I will direct "The Bench"

Iran Theater- Mehravaran said: "If the situation becomes normal, I will direct the one-character and the monologue play" Bench ".
In an interview with Iran Theater, Ezzatollah Mehravaran, a veteran and well-known actor and director talked about his new theatrical activities, "In recent months, I have had the opportunity to act in several TV series. I have also written the play" Bench " and I am waiting for the performance conditions of the show to improve.”
He stated about the theme and atmosphere of the play "Bench": I had written the original of this play in 1973 and lately I rewrote it according to the current conditions of the society. The story is about a woman coming and going in an abandoned park and there is only one bench in it. The woman sits on the bench and tells the people passing by that she will die in 45 minutes. She takes out a number of condolence pages from inside her bag and starts reading to people. The last page of condolence she gets from inside her bag belongs to herself. The one-character show is performed in a monologue.”
Regarding the venue for the performance, he said: "I had talks with the Veteran Art Institute to prepare a hall for the play, which has been postponed due to the Coronavirus pandemic."
Mehravaran explained about the choice of the actress for his show: "Because the play is a single character, I plan to use one of the experienced actresses with theatrical backgorund to cope with this difficult role, and I have several options in mind that I have not yet reached a final conclusion."
